I am russian immigrant. So yeah, dont worry they dont bite. Their churches differ from each other wildly, looks like you are being invited to one of the more conservative ones. So just go with the flow, like when they all stand up to pray, do the same, smile and nod whenever needed :-), and um yeah. You'll be fine.

Of course you might get a comment from a babushka (grandma) or a dedushka (grandpa) about something wrong with like whatever your wearing, but thats alright. I'm used to that, so whenever I go to one of these churches where they have strict dress code, I just kinda conform to the code and they all think I am one of them.

Just tell your kids not to pick any fights.
